American Travel Sentiment Study - Wave 67
It’s Full Speed Ahead for Holiday Travel Planning

According to the latest Longwoods International tracking study of American travelers, 92% have travel plans in the next six months, tied for the highest levels seen since the beginning of the pandemic.  Seventy percent plan to visit friends and family on their holiday trips, while 60% of those with Holiday Travel plans will be shopping, and 47% plan to enjoy holiday lighting displays.

“It’s encouraging to see such strong demand for travel during the important holiday season,” said Amir Eylon, President and CEO of Longwoods International.  “The negative impact of both COVID-19 and gas prices have declined significantly, and travelers are ready to enjoy the holidays with friends and family around the country.”

Interest in visiting museums, galleries and other cultural institutions during holiday trips increased from 21% of travelers last year to 27% in 2022.  And more holiday travelers plan to attend fairs, festivals and live performances than in 2021.

The survey, supported by Miles Partnership, was fielded October 26, 2022 using a national sample randomly drawn from a consumer panel of 1,000 adults, ages 18 and over.  Quotas were used to match Census targets for age, gender, and region to make the survey representative of the U. S. population.
